HE IS THE LEADER OF THE BAND OF THESE 24 STUDENTS AT SAINT JOSEPH HIGH SCHOOL. MICHAEL PETRISKY IS SHARING HIS LOVE FOR MUSIC WITH HIS STUDENTS, AS THEY PRACTICE TOGETHER ON THIS DAY. A TYPICAL BAND PRACTICE MAY BEGIN BRIGHT AND EARLY AT 7 IN THE MORNING. SOMETIMES MARCHING IN THE GRASS BEFORE THE BIRDS BEGIN CHIRPING.

"It's a family type situation. We're all together so much of the year. With marching band practice at 7 in the morning. We're out there with the dew, the mosquitoes and the trains. And everything else that comes by sometimes the dear are out there." said Michael Petrisky

<"Well he's gotten to know us all pretty well. He has a special relationship with each of us. And he's always there trying to help us out and you can really tell he cares about us.">Danielle Foxell\Student

<"He's helped me be a better person. And helped me play my instrument better. I get here early and when I get in, he's always telling me to do things for him. And When I get stuff done, he says thank you for everything.">Timothy Gibson\Student

GETTING THE BAND TO ALL BLEND AND PLAY IN HARMONY CAN BE CHALLENGING AT FIRST. BUT MICHAEL PETRISKY DOES IT ALL WITH A SMILE ON HIS FACE. HIS ENCOURAGING SMILE AND HIGH EXPECTATIONS HELP THE STUDENTS TO HAVE THAT BIG BAND SOUND WITH ONLY 24 PLAYERS. AND WHEN THEY REACH ANOTHER PLATEAU. HE SETS EVEN HIGH CHALLENGES.

<"I have 2 more years with him. So there is so much to learn. He just has a really good connection with us and he's easy to get along with and I've never had a bad day. I can just talk to him about anything.">Hilary Kristynik\Student

BUT WORK IN PREPARING THE BAND FOR CONCERTS AND SPORTS IS A 7 DAY A WEEK JOB. OFTEN HAVING PRACTICE AND PERFORMANCES ON THE WEEKEND. HE WANTS HIS STUDENTS TO LOOK AND SOUND THEIR BEST IN PUBLIC.

<"I';ve been very very blessed here with some students that care and do what I ask them to do, even if they may not agree with it to make the show. And I think thru that cohesiveness, things that go on in the family, disagreements and agreements and play, we try to have a lot of playing with our work too. It's a unique situation.">Michael Petrisky\Educator Of The Week

BUT IT'S THAT COMBINATION OF HARD WORK AND DISCIPLINE THAT PAYS OFF WITH EVERY PERFORMANCE.
